Sewage Water Removal Cost in White Center, WA

The cost of sewage water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in White Center, WA.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Containment and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area and severity of damage
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area and type of drying equipment used
Disinfection and Cleaning $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and type of disinfectants used
Restoration and Repairs $1,000 – $10,000 Scope of repairs and materials needed

The final cost of sewage water removal will depend on the specifics of your situation. We offer free estimates and assessments to provide you with a clear understanding of the costs involved.

Q: How do I prevent sewage water damage in the future?

A: To prevent sewage water damage, it’s essential to maintain your plumbing system regularly. Check for leaks, clogs, and other issues before they become major problems. Also, consider installing a backflow prevention device to prevent sewage water from backing up into your home.
